Hi, I am working on a project using the PT8211, and running into an issue where I am seeing a pronounced ~2kHz noise on the output of the chip. This happens even when I write super stripped down audio code that completely zeros the output, and disable all other electronic functionality on my PCB.
Any idea what might be causing this and how I can fix this?
Here is the relevant section of my schematic (all functionality outside the PT8211 is disabled for testing) and the noise I am seeing on my scope (measured at both PT8211 output pins, before and after decoupling caps), as well as the code snippet I am using to test:
